.reusable-component{position:relative;margin:auto;max-width:1600px;padding-bottom:61px}.reusable-component:after{content:"";width:100vw!important;height:100%;position:absolute;background-position:center center;background-size:contain;background-repeat:no-repeat;background-attachment:unset;top:0;left:50%;transform:translate(-50%);z-index:0}.reusable-component .isolate{z-index:1}.reusable-component .card .card__inner .card__media{border-radius:20px 20px 0 0}.reusable-component .card--standard>.card__content{background-color:#fff;border-radius:0 0 20px 20px}.reusable-component .card__heading{display:block!important}.reusable-component .collection__view-all .button{max-width:200px;width:100%;margin-left:auto;margin-right:auto;margin-top:40px}.reusable-component .grid.product-grid.slider.slider--desktop{column-gap:13px}.reusable-component .grid.product-grid{row-gap:12px;column-gap:12px}.reusable-component .grid.product-grid .grid__item{width:24.2%}.reusable-component .slider.slider--desktop .scroll-trigger.animate--slide-in{margin-left:0}.reusable-component .slider.slider--desktop .grid__item{width:24.2%;padding-top:0;padding-bottom:0}.reusable-component .collection .grid.product-grid .grid__item .card{background-color:transparent!important}.reusable-component .collection .grid.product-grid .grid__item .card__content{background:var(--gradient-background)!important}.reusable-component .collection{position:relative;padding-left:1.5rem;padding-right:2.5rem}.reusable-component .collection:has(.grid.product-grid){padding-left:2.5rem;padding-right:2.5rem}.reusable-component .product-grid .grid__item .product-card-wrapper:hover{transform:scale(1.05) rotateY(5deg);transition:transform .4s ease}.reusable-component .collection .slider-buttons{justify-content:space-between;position:absolute;top:50%;transform:translateY(-50%);width:100%;display:none}.reusable-component .collection .slider-buttons .slider-button--prev{position:relative;left:-88px;max-width:60px}.reusable-component .collection .slider-buttons .slider-button--next{position:relative;right:-78px;max-width:60px}.reusable-component .collection slider-component{padding-right:10px;padding-left:10px}.reusable-component:hover .slider-buttons{display:flex!important}.reusable-component .products-slider h2.title.h1{text-align:center!important}.reusable-component .slider.slider--desktop{scroll-padding-left:10px;padding-top:10px;padding-bottom:20px;padding-left:10px}.reusable-component:hover .slider:not(.slider--everywhere):not(.slider--desktop)+.slider-buttons,.reusable-component .slider:not(.slider--everywhere):not(.slider--desktop)+.slider-buttons{display:none!important}@media only screen and (max-width: 1800px){.reusable-component .collection .slider-buttons .slider-button--prev{left:-10px}.reusable-component .collection .slider-buttons .slider-button--next{right:0}.reusable-component .collection__view-all .button{font-size:18px;line-height:24px}}@media only screen and (max-width: 1100px){.reusable-component .slider.slider--desktop .grid__item{width:32.2%;max-width:35%}.reusable-component .products-slider h2.title.h1{font-size:36px;line-height:42px}.reusable-component .collection__view-all .button{margin-top:24px}.reusable-component .collection__view-all .button{font-size:16px;line-height:22px;max-width:160px!important}.reusable-component .collection .grid.product-grid:not(.slider--desktop) .grid__item{width:19.1%}.reusable-component .collection:has(.grid.product-grid){padding-right:2.5rem}.reusable-component .collection .grid.product-grid .grid__item .card--media .card__inner .card__content{min-height:fit-content!important}}@media only screen and (min-width: 769px) and (max-width: 1100px){.reusable-component .collection .slider-buttons{display:flex!important}.reusable-component .products-slider h2.title.h1{font-size:30px;line-height:38px}}@media only screen and (min-width: 990px){.reusable-component .slider--desktop:after{padding-left:5px}}@media only screen and (max-width: 990px){.reusable-component .collection .grid.product-grid:not(.slider--desktop) .grid__item{width:24.2%!important}}@media screen and (max-width: 768px){.reusable-component .card--standard>.card__content{border-radius:0 0 10px 10px}.reusable-component .card .card__inner .card__media,.reusable-component .products-slider .card__media img{border-radius:10px 10px 0 0}.reusable-component .collection .slider-buttons{display:none!important}.reusable-component .collection{padding-left:0;padding-right:0}.reusable-component .collection:not(:has(.grid.product-grid.slider--desktop)){padding-left:16px;padding-right:16px}.reusable-component .collection:has(.grid.product-grid.slider--desktop){padding-left:0!important;padding-right:0!important}.reusable-component .collection slider-component{padding-right:0!important;padding-left:0!important}.reusable-component .slider.slider--desktop .grid__item .card--media .card__inner .card__content{min-height:fit-content!important}.reusable-component .slider.slider--desktop .grid__item{width:46%;max-width:46%;min-width:174px}.reusable-component .products-slider h2.title.h1{font-size:22px;line-height:28px}.reusable-component .collection__view-all .button{font-size:14px;line-height:20px;height:46px;min-height:46px}.reusable-component .slider.slider--desktop{column-gap:8px!important}.reusable-component .slider.slider--desktop{padding-left:8px!important}.reusable-component .collection .grid.product-grid:not(.slider--desktop) .grid__item{width:100%!important;max-width:48%!important;min-width:unset!important}}
/*# sourceMappingURL=/cdn/shop/t/89/assets/collection-section-reusable-component.css.map */
